What does a Director of Operations do?

A Director of Operations oversees the daily activities of a company or organization, ensuring that business processes run efficiently and effectively. They are responsible for implementing policies, managing budgets, optimizing workflows, and coordinating between departments to achieve organizational goals. This role often involves strategic planning, problem-solving, and leading teams to improve productivity and profitability. Directors of Operations play a key part in shaping company culture and driving operational excellence.

Is operations director a high position?

An Operations Director is a senior leadership role responsible for overseeing daily business functions, strategic planning, and operational efficiency. It is generally considered a high-level position within an organization, often reporting to executive management such as the CEO or COO.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Director of Operations,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Director of Operations, you need strong leadership, strategic planning, and operational management skills, typically supported by a bachelor’s or master’s degree in business or a related field. Familiarity with enterprise resource planning (ERP) systems, project management tools, and relevant certifications like Six Sigma or PMP is often expected. Exceptional communication, problem-solving, and decision-making abilities help you lead teams and drive organizational efficiency. These competencies are crucial for ensuring seamless business operations, meeting organizational goals, and fostering continuous improvement.

What are some common challenges faced by Directors of Operations when leading cross-functional teams?

Directors of Operations often encounter challenges such as aligning different departmental goals, managing communication gaps, and balancing competing priorities among team members. Successfully addressing these issues requires strong leadership, clear communication, and the ability to foster collaboration across diverse teams. Directors must also be adept at conflict resolution and change management to ensure that operational objectives are met efficiently while maintaining a positive team dynamic.

We are seeking an experienced Cloud Operations Leader to build, scale, and lead our Cloud Operations organization. This role owns the end-to-end operational performance for our Enterprise Imaging cloud platform, supporting mission critical and highly regulated SaaS environments. The Cloud Operations Leader defines and operates industry standard operating models to ensure reliability, availability, scalability, compliance, effective security operations execution, and disciplined financial stewardship.
In close collaboration with Solution Architecture, Engineering, Product Management, Security (SecOps), Finance, Program Management, and customer facing teams, the Cloud Operations Leader embeds modern SRE and SysOps practices into the delivery and operation of cloud and hybrid solutions.
Location:
  • Remote - US / Canada

What You'll Do:
Cloud Operations & Reliability
  • Own the operational health, stability, and performance of all production cloud platforms and shared services.
  • Manage SLAs, error budgets, and operational KPIs aligned to customer experience, availability commitments, and business priorities.
  • Serve as the operational authority during major incidents, leading response, escalation, communication, and post-incident remediation.
  • Partner with the Customer Support organization in escalation management and issue resolution to ensure clear escalation paths, rapid resolution, and consistent customer impact communications.
  • Establish operational readiness, integrate change management, and release governance standards.
  • Design sustainable on-call, escalation, and follow-the-sun support models.
  • Drive automation, self-healing, and systematic toil reduction to improve reliability and operational efficiency.

Cloud Platform & Infrastructure
  • Own the lifecycle and operations of AWS-first cloud platforms
  • Ensure resilience, disaster recovery, backup, and business continuity objectives are met and tested.
  • Partner with architecture and engineering teams to ensure reliability-by-design,
  • Oversee capacity planning, performance engineering, and scaling strategies aligned with commercial strategies.

Automation, DevOps & Observability
  • Partner with R&D to standardize CI/CD pipelines, release processes, and platform automation.
  • Own end-to-end observability including metrics, logs, traces, dashboards, and alerting.
  • Continuously improve MTTR, MTTD, and deployment reliability.

Security, Compliance & Risk (with SecOps)
  • Implement and operate security controls defined by SecOps across cloud platforms and operational processes.
  • Ensure compliance with regulatory frameworks (e.g., HIPAA, SOC2, ISO, NIST as applicable).
  • Support audits, vulnerability management, patching, and risk remediation.

Team & Organizational Leadership
  • Leads cloud operations through transformation, including the transition from traditional delivery models to a SaaS-first operating model.
  • Build, lead, and develop a high-performing and efficient global Cloud Operations / SRE organization.
  • Hire, coach, and retain top talent; establish career paths, training, and certification programs.
  • Manage strategic vendors and partners to provide 24/7 operational coverage.
  • Foster a culture of ownership, accountability, and continuous improvement.
  • Influence effectively in a matrixed organization, driving adoption of new operating models.

Who You Are:
  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or equivalent practical experience.
  • 10+ years of experience operating and scaling cloud-based production platforms, including business critical SaaS services.
  • 5+ years of proven leadership experience building, scaling, and leading Cloud Operations and/or SRE teams in a 24/7 global environment.
  • Demonstrated ownership of operational reliability, availability, and performance.
  • Deep expertise in AWS-first cloud platforms and cloud native architectures
  • Strong experience with automation-driven operations.
  • Solid background in ITIL-aligned service management, including incident, problem, change, and capacity management.
  • Experience operating in regulated or compliance-driven environments
  • Proven ability to partner effectively with Engineering, Architecture, Security, Support, and business stakeholders to deliver reliability-by-design.
  • Strong leadership, communication, and stakeholder management skills, with the ability to translate operational risk, reliability, and performance into executive-level and business-relevant insight.
  • Experience leading global, multi-region service organizations supporting enterprise customers.
  • Relevant industry experience in medical imaging and Imaging IT
  • Relevant certifications such as AWS Cloud Practitioner, AWS Certified Solutions Architect, ITIL, CISSP, or CISM.
